Transaction d95cb5dea6d2263368a37b5188f9e883ba258ec6f5cbdb892da4209076025833
1 Input
1 Output
-
d95cb5dea6d2263368a37b5188f9e883ba258ec6f5cbdb892da4209076025833:0
- value
- 342417
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 2cc0db18f14453932fd327cfaa066b1306672724 OP_EQUAL
- address
- 35megqtC1dg6yZZtzyxNuEZgLMVxzTk3Np